How does a tourist visa work?

A tourist eVisa (Electronic Visa) is an official electronic document, which permits foreigners to arrive and travel around Djibouti to sightsee. The eVisa is electronically bound to your passport as opposed to the traditional visas whereby you have to be physically stickered or stamped at the embassy.

To ASEAN nationals, it implies that you can submit an application when you are at the comfort of your own home in Bangkok, Jakarta, or Manila. Upon approval, the visa is mailed through email; you just need to print it out and submit the same to the immigration officers when you arrive at the Ambouli International Airport.

How do I apply for an eVisa for Djibouti?

The application process is designed to be simple and traveler-friendly. Follow these steps to  Apply for Djibouti eVisa  and secure your travel authorization without unnecessary delays.


  1. Fill the Online Form: Enter your personal details, passport info, and travel dates.

  2. Upload Documents: Scan and upload your passport bio-page and digital photograph.

  3. Pay the Fee: Use a secure online payment method to cover the visa and service charges.

  4. Receive Approval: Monitor your email. Once approved, download and print the PDF version of your eVisa.

Can I extend my e-visa?

As of today, the Djibouti eVisa is not renewable after the issuance. In case of a change in your travel plans and you have to stay beyond the 14 or the 90 days in which you have been allowed then you must leave the country. Then it is possible to apply to another eVisa in another country. In the case of long residence or multiple entry requirements, the ASEAN members are advised to approach a Djiboutian embassy for a traditional sticker visa.

What are the best sightseeing spots to visit in Djibouti?

Djibouti is a nation of contrasts with volcanic sweeps contrasting with the colorful coral reefs. These are the places you cannot afford to skip in case you are seeking a journey that will make you feel like you are on another planet.




  1. Lake Assal: Located in a volcanic crater, this is the lowest point in Africa. The water is incredibly salty, creating brilliant white shores that contrast with deep turquoise waves.

  2. Lake Abbé: Known for its surreal limestone chimneys that vent steam, this area looks like a science fiction movie set and is home to nomadic Afar tribes.

  3. Day Forest National Park: A lush oasis in the Goda Mountains, providing a cool refuge and a chance to see rare juniper forests and unique wildlife.

  4. Moucha Island: A short boat ride from the capital, offering pristine white sand beaches and some of the best snorkeling and diving spots in the Red Sea.
